bool PCB_EDIT_FRAME::Other_Layer_Route( TRACK* aTrack, wxDC* DC )
{
    unsigned    itmp;

    if( aTrack == NULL )
    {
        if( getActiveLayer() != ((PCB_SCREEN*)GetScreen())->m_Route_Layer_TOP )
            setActiveLayer( ((PCB_SCREEN*)GetScreen())->m_Route_Layer_TOP );
        else
            setActiveLayer(((PCB_SCREEN*)GetScreen())->m_Route_Layer_BOTTOM );

        UpdateStatusBar();
        return true;
    }

    /* Avoid more than one via on the current location: */
    if( GetBoard()->GetViaByPosition( g_CurrentTrackSegment->m_End,
                                      g_CurrentTrackSegment->GetLayer() ) )
        return false;

    for( TRACK* segm = g_FirstTrackSegment;  segm;  segm = segm->Next() )
    {
        if( segm->Type() == TYPE_VIA && g_CurrentTrackSegment->m_End == segm->m_Start )
            return false;
    }

    /* Is the current segment Ok (no DRC error) ? */
    if( Drc_On )
    {
        if( BAD_DRC==m_drc->Drc( g_CurrentTrackSegment, GetBoard()->m_Track ) )
            /* DRC error, the change layer is not made */
            return false;

        // Handle 2 segments.
        if( g_TwoSegmentTrackBuild && g_CurrentTrackSegment->Back() )
        {
            if( BAD_DRC == m_drc->Drc( g_CurrentTrackSegment->Back(), GetBoard()->m_Track ) )
                return false;
        }
    }

    /* Save current state before placing a via.
     * If the via cannot be placed this current state will be reused
     */
    itmp = g_CurrentTrackList.GetCount();
    Begin_Route( g_CurrentTrackSegment, DC );

    DrawPanel->m_mouseCaptureCallback( DrawPanel, DC, wxDefaultPosition, false );

    /* create the via */
    SEGVIA* via    = new SEGVIA( GetBoard() );
    via->m_Flags   = IS_NEW;
    via->m_Shape   = GetBoard()->GetBoardDesignSettings()->m_CurrentViaType;
    via->m_Width   = GetBoard()->GetCurrentViaSize();
    via->SetNet( GetBoard()->GetHighLightNetCode() );
    via->m_Start   = via->m_End = g_CurrentTrackSegment->m_End;

    // Usual via is from copper to component.
    // layer pair is LAYER_N_BACK and LAYER_N_FRONT.
    via->SetLayerPair( LAYER_N_BACK, LAYER_N_FRONT );
    via->SetDrillValue( GetBoard()->GetCurrentViaDrill() );

    int first_layer = getActiveLayer();
    int last_layer;

    // prepare switch to new active layer:
    if( first_layer != GetScreen()->m_Route_Layer_TOP )
        last_layer = GetScreen()->m_Route_Layer_TOP;
    else
        last_layer = GetScreen()->m_Route_Layer_BOTTOM;

    /* Adjust the actual via layer pair */
    switch ( via->Shape() )
    {
        case VIA_BLIND_BURIED:
            via->SetLayerPair( first_layer, last_layer );
            break;

        case VIA_MICROVIA:  // from external to the near neighbor inner layer
        {
            int last_inner_layer = GetBoard()->GetCopperLayerCount() - 2;
            if ( first_layer == LAYER_N_BACK )
                last_layer = LAYER_N_2;
            else if ( first_layer == LAYER_N_FRONT )
                last_layer = last_inner_layer;
            else if ( first_layer == LAYER_N_2 )
                last_layer = LAYER_N_BACK;
            else if ( first_layer == last_inner_layer )
                last_layer = LAYER_N_FRONT;

            // else error: will be removed later
            via->SetLayerPair( first_layer, last_layer );
            {
                NETINFO_ITEM* net = GetBoard()->FindNet( via->GetNet() );
                via->m_Width      = net->GetMicroViaSize();
            }
        }
            break;

        default:
            break;
    }

    if( Drc_On && BAD_DRC == m_drc->Drc( via, GetBoard()->m_Track ) )
    {
        /* DRC fault: the Via cannot be placed here ... */
        delete via;

        DrawPanel->m_mouseCaptureCallback( DrawPanel, DC, wxDefaultPosition, false );

        // delete the track(s) added in Begin_Route()
        while( g_CurrentTrackList.GetCount() > itmp )
        {
            Delete_Segment( DC, g_CurrentTrackSegment );
        }

         SetCurItem( g_CurrentTrackSegment, false );

        // Refresh DRC diag, erased by previous calls
        if( m_drc->GetCurrentMarker() )
            m_drc->GetCurrentMarker()->DisplayInfo( this );

        return false;
    }

    setActiveLayer( last_layer );

    TRACK*  lastNonVia = g_CurrentTrackSegment;

    /* A new via was created. It was Ok.
     */
    g_CurrentTrackList.PushBack( via );

    /* The via is now in linked list and we need a new track segment
     * after the via, starting at via location.
     * it will become the new current segment (from via to the mouse cursor)
     */

    TRACK* track = lastNonVia->Copy();

    /* the above creates a new segment from the last entered segment, with the
     * current width, flags, netcode, etc... values.
     * layer, start and end point are not correct,
     * and will be modified next
     */

    // set the layer to the new value
    track->SetLayer( getActiveLayer() );

    /* the start point is the via position and the end point is the cursor
     * which also is on the via (will change when moving mouse)
     */
    track->m_Start = track->m_End = via->m_Start;

    g_CurrentTrackList.PushBack( track );

    if( g_TwoSegmentTrackBuild )
    {
        // Create a second segment (we must have 2 track segments to adjust)
        g_CurrentTrackList.PushBack( g_CurrentTrackSegment->Copy() );
    }

    DrawPanel->m_mouseCaptureCallback( DrawPanel, DC, wxDefaultPosition, false );
    via->DisplayInfo( this );

    UpdateStatusBar();

    return true;
}
